Types of Real Estate Home Videos for Miami Properties
Miami’s vibrant real estate market benefits from a diverse array of video formats that cater to different property types, target audiences, and marketing goals. Recognizing which type of video best showcases a property can significantly influence its appeal and the speed of sale.
Virtual Property Tours: These comprehensive videos allow prospective buyers to explore a property remotely, experiencing the layout, flow, and spatial dynamics firsthand. They are especially beneficial for attracting out-of-town clients or international buyers who cannot view the property in person. Virtual tours can be interactive, with clickable hotspots that provide additional details about specific features.

Drone Footage: Aerial shots captured with drones offer an expansive view of the property and its surroundings. For Miami properties, drone videos emphasize scenic features such as waterfront access, lush landscaping, or proximity to beaches and parks. A well-executed drone video not only highlights the property’s physical attributes but also strategic locations within the neighborhood.

Walkthrough Videos: Guided walkthroughs feature a real estate agent or presenter guiding viewers through the home. This format humanizes the property, allowing potential buyers to experience the space as if they were physically present. Narration can emphasize unique features, recent upgrades, and lifestyle benefits that resonate with Miami’s diverse clientele.
Integrating these varied formats into a cohesive marketing strategy enhances engagement, providing tailored content that meets the expectations of different segments of buyers. Combining the immersive element of virtual tours, the striking visuals from drone footage, and personal connection via walkthroughs creates a comprehensive visual storytelling package that captures much of Miami’s real estate essence.
Key Elements of Successful Real Estate Home Videos
Creating compelling real estate home videos that resonate with prospective buyers requires meticulous attention to several core elements. These components ensure that videos are not only visually appealing but also foster an emotional connection, prompting viewers to imagine themselves living in the showcased Miami property. Mastering these aspects can significantly enhance a property's online presence and influence buyer engagement.
- Lighting: Optimal lighting is essential to highlight the home’s best features. Utilizing natural light during the day can make interiors appear warm and inviting, accentuating spaciousness and architectural details. For interior shots, supplemental lighting may be employed to eliminate shadows and ensure even illumination, particularly in areas with limited natural light.
- Staging: Proper staging transforms a space into an aspirational lifestyle setting. Clear, uncluttered rooms with tasteful decor allow viewers to envision their own lives within the space. In Miami’s vibrant market, staging can also reflect local style trends, blending modern sophistication with tropical accents to appeal to a diverse demographic.
- Camera Angles and Movement: Dynamic camera work adds depth and perspective to videos. Wide-angle shots capture entire rooms, giving viewers a sense of scale, while strategic camera angles emphasize the property’s unique features. Smooth, controlled movement through panning and tracking shots creates a professional flow, guiding viewers seamlessly through the property.
- Scripting and Narrative: A well-crafted narration or on-screen text helps emphasize key property highlights, recent upgrades, and neighborhood benefits. Clear, concise communication tailored to Miami’s buyers—whether they’re local or international—enhances the story and keeps viewer interest high.
- Sound and Audio Quality: Crisp audio clarity, whether through narration or background music, complements visual elements. Avoiding distracting noise and choosing appropriate background music can evoke the desired emotional response, such as relaxation or excitement.

Consistency in applying these elements across different video formats creates a unified and professional marketing portfolio. Whether showcasing a beachfront condo or a lush Miami estate, attention to these crucial factors ensures videos meet high standards of quality and engagement, effectively capturing the essence of Miami’s diverse real estate offerings.
Strategies for Producing Effective Real Estate Home Videos in Miami
To maximize the impact of your real estate videos, it’s essential to employ proven production techniques that highlight the unique aspects of Miami properties. First, comprehensive planning prior to filming ensures you capture all essential features of the property, from panoramic views to intricate interior details. This involves creating a shot list that includes key rooms, outdoor spaces, and distinctive selling points such as waterfront access or luxury upgrades.
Next, focus on professional lighting setup to enhance the property’s visual appeal, particularly in rooms with limited natural light. Utilizing diffused lighting and reflectors can eliminate shadows and create a warm, inviting atmosphere that resonates with viewers. Consistent daylight filming is preferred for exterior shots to maintain uniformity and showcase the property in its best natural light.
Regarding camera equipment, high-definition cameras coupled with stabilizers or gimbals are critical for capturing smooth motion footage. Wide-angle lenses can emphasize the spaciousness of rooms and outdoor areas, offering viewers a comprehensive perspective. When filming exterior spaces, drone footage provides stunning aerial views that can highlight features such as large pools, landscaping, or proximity to the beach, which are highly appealing in the Miami market.

Post-production editing is equally crucial. Professional editing can refine color grading to match Miami’s vibrant aesthetic, incorporate seamless transitions, and add licensed music that complements the property’s style. Including animated text overlays or virtual staging can further illustrate potential renovations or highlight main features, engaging viewers effectively.
It’s important to remember that authenticity in visual storytelling fosters trust. Showcase the property’s best attributes naturally and avoid overuse of exaggerated effects that may mislead viewers. Ensuring that videos are concise but comprehensive allows potential buyers to get a true feel for the space without overwhelming them. Overall, strategic camera work, quality editing, and attention to detail contribute to compelling real estate videos that elevate your Miami property listings and attract qualified buyers.
Legal and Ethical Considerations in Real Estate Video Production
Creating compelling real estate home videos in Miami requires adherence to established standards that safeguard transparency and uphold industry integrity. From the initial planning stages to final cut, producers should ensure all content accurately represents the property’s features without embellishment or misdirection. This involves honest portrayal of the home's condition, layout, and available amenities, which helps potential buyers form realistic expectations and fosters trust in the listing.
To maintain ethical standards, it is vital to obtain proper permissions before filming, especially for properties with shared amenities, private outdoor spaces, or restricted access areas. Clear communication with property owners ensures that all parties are aware of filming procedures and content intended for public distribution, preventing misunderstandings or disputes.
Respect for privacy is paramount. Video shoots should avoid capturing confidential areas or personal belongings that are not meant for public viewing. When including footage of interiors, care should be taken to prevent inadvertently revealing sensitive information, such as alarm codes, personal identification, or private documents.
Music, images, or footage from third-party sources incorporated into the videos must be properly licensed or created specifically for the project. Using copyrighted material without authorization can lead to legal issues and damage credibility. A reputable Miami-based production agency will handle licensing and ensure all content complies with intellectual property rights.
Additionally, transparency about the capabilities and limitations of the property, including any renovations or known issues, maintains honesty and supports ethical marketing practices. Clear disclosure avoids misleading potential buyers, reinforcing professionalism and building long-term relationships in the Miami real estate market.
Ultimately, the alignment of production practices with ethical standards not only protects all parties involved but also elevates the reputation of your listings, making them more attractive to discerning buyers seeking honest and professionally created real estate content.
Effective Strategies for Promoting Your Miami Home Video Content
Maximizing the reach and impact of real estate home videos requires a strategic approach tailored to the Miami market's unique characteristics. Utilizing official channels and proven content promotion methods ensures your listings gain visibility among qualified buyers and industry professionals.
One of the most impactful strategies involves integrating videos directly into reputed online real estate platforms that are popular within the Miami area. These platforms often have targeted audiences seeking luxury waterfront properties, condos, or multi-family units, providing an opportunity to showcase your video content to highly interested viewers.
Leveraging social media is equally essential. Platforms such as Instagram, Facebook, and LinkedIn offer advanced advertising options that allow precise demographic targeting—focusing on age, income levels, geographic location within Miami, and property interests. Creating engaging, short-form snippets for platforms like Instagram Reels or TikTok can generate high engagement and direct traffic to full-length videos hosted on your professional website or listing pages.
Search engine optimization (SEO) enhances discoverability by ensuring your videos are optimized with relevant keywords, such as Miami waterfront homes or luxury condos in Miami. Proper metadata, including descriptive titles, tags, and detailed video descriptions, aligns your content with what potential buyers are actively searching for, increasing organic reach.

Additionally, email marketing campaigns tailored to your existing client database and potential buyers in your geographic area are an excellent way to share new video content. Personalizing messages that highlight the property's unique features captured in your videos fosters a sense of exclusivity and encourages engagement.
Partnering with local real estate influencers or industry experts in Miami can expand your reach further. Collaborations can include live virtual tours, Q&A sessions, or shared content that amplifies exposure across multiple channels, leveraging their followers to attract new potential buyers.
Finally, tracking performance metrics of your video campaigns—such as views, click-through rates, and engagement levels—provides critical insights. Using this data allows for continuous refinement of your promotional strategies, ensuring maximum visibility and a higher likelihood of generating serious inquiries and sales.
